Chutney

speak

Chutney is a spicy condiment originating from the Indian subcontinent. It is typically made from a variety of ingredients such as fruits, vegetables, herbs, and spices, and is served as a side dish or used as a topping for various Indian and Southeast Asian dishes, such as samosas, naan bread, and grilled meats. Chutneys can range in color from green to brown to red, depending on the ingredients used, and can have a range of flavors depending on the type of chilies or spices added.

Chutzpah

speak

Chutzpah is a Yiddish word that refers to a type of audacity, nerve, or impudence, particularly when it is accompanied by a lack of shame or remorse. It can also describe someone who has the courage and confidence to do something considered bold or reckless.
